Published record

v=DMARC1; p=none; rua=mailto:rua@dmarc.brevo.com

What this means

  • Policy p=none: monitoring only, no unauthenticated message is blocked.
  • SPF ends with ~all (softfail): acceptable while observing, aim for -all in the end.
  • No DKIM key found on the common selectors (the domain may use non-standard selectors).

About Mairie de Saint-Amand-les-Eaux

The Mairie de Saint-Amand-les-Eaux is the administrative institution responsible for the governance and representation of the commune of Saint-Amand-les-Eaux, located in the Nord department, in the Hauts-de-France region, within the arrondissement of Valenciennes. It serves as the seat of local executive power, led by the elected mayor and municipal council, and embodies the communal authority responsible for implementing decisions falling within the town's competence. Saint-Amand-les-Eaux is a historic commune known in particular for its Benedictine abbey, its abbey tower, and its thermal activities, elements that have shaped its urban development and heritage identity over the centuries. The commune is also situated within a remarkable natural environment, near forested areas connected to the Scarpe-Escaut Regional Nature Park. The town hall draws on this history and geographical setting to guide some of its local policies, particularly regarding heritage and environmental enhancement. In terms of its mission, the town hall exercises the usual competences assigned to French communes: management of civil status records, issuance of administrative documents, organization of local public services, urban planning and land-use management, management of municipal facilities, social, educational and cultural action, as well as maintenance of roads and public spaces. It also serves as the interface between residents and the various administrative levels, whether intercommunal, departmental, or national. Its role encompasses the preparation and execution of the municipal budget, the coordination of municipal services, and the implementation of development projects decided by the municipal council.
